$50 a piece at the local pick n' pull a part BRZ seats are awesome but I don't think anyone will be getting rid of them any time soon or end up at the junkyard.
It's possible to change the entire seat base over but, I modified the bugeye seat rails to work in my car.
Front 2 are exact but the 2 rear bolt locations are off by an inch

I'm sure it's easy to move the seat warmers over to a new seat. I had to move the passenger occupant sensor over which is most likely a similar process.
